Ramsey - Cup win showed our character

By Rob Kelly

Aaron Ramsey says Arsenal demonstrated their character in coming back from two goals down to beat Aston Villa on Sunday.

Arsène Wenger's side seemed to be heading out of the FA Cup after Richard Dunne and Darren Bent struck to put Villa into a half-time lead. But three goals in a magical seven-minute spell saw the Gunners complete a remarkable comeback to progress to the fifth round.

"I thought we played pretty well [in the first half] but we were sloppy on a couple of occasions and paid the price for it. We came out in the second half, believed in our qualities and carried on going, and it paid off in the end," Ramsey told Arsenal Player.

"We showed our character and our belief. To be 2-0 down at half time it is a tough task to come back and win the game, so I am really proud of the way we played."
